OK, ignore most of the previous post. I seriously doubt you will be around long enough to get to assembly line. And I snooped in some more of your cities. You have THREE GG's sleeping....settle them somewhere. I would spread them to your three best production cities.
Start teching railroad ASAP. Trade Communism to HC for theology and nationalism. Use one of your GE's for a golden age, and revolt to nationalism/theology and start drafting like crazy. Not the best use of a GE, but if you're dead then it won't matter. Bulb part of Railroad with the other GE. Build cannons to weaken his SOD, draft redcoats all over the place for defense...not just from shaka but from his vassals as well. And then start building machine guns when railroad is completed. Finish biology and trade it for constitution then trade RR for corporation. tech assembly line. And hope you're not dead. Run an engineer in London to try and get another GE for mining inc. or to build the pentagon.

Yes war with shaka is on the horizon...but not like you are planning. The heel in shaka's iron curtain is descending upon you.

Counter espionage only makes it more expensive for the enemy. and you need to d it every 10 turns. Doing it every 2 doesn't help. To stop spies you need to keep a spy in each city. Or build a security bureau (available at democracy i believe).

@ slickshooter. You didn't play too badly but you sort of skipped some things.
A. you need a Great person farm. It's the mid 1800's and you still don't have the national epic built.
B. you started with shaka to the north and monty to the south, it's pretty impressive that you're not dead yet. If Monty is your neighbor he should usually be target #1. With shaka if you let him expand he will become a monster.
C. saving up GG's is not the best idea. Settle them for the exp points and use 1 or 2 for a super healer. Usually a chariot/scout/explorer with 6exp plus a great general to get MedicIII
D. If you get boxed in like that, you need to sound the war horn. In this case Monty to the south. Taking him out would leave you only one border to defend while you deal with shaka.
